Price
It doesn't have to be expensive to incorporate a gym into your home. There are many treadmills at a reasonable price that offer a sturdy surface for running or walking on, and a luminous display to keep track of your progress. Many also have preset workouts that you can follow along with connectivity to fitness wearables and smartphones which allows you to upload your data to apps such as Strava and MapMyRun.
Most treadmills come with an adjustable incline. However, more expensive models may have automated settings that automatically adjust to your heart rate. These are great for beginners. You can find treadmills at retailers like Fitness Superstore, John Lewis and Amazon. It's worth comparing prices.
A few treadmills that are budget-friendly have a slim design that allows them to be more compact than larger ones and they're easy to fold when not in use. These treadmills are ideal for those who wish to save money on running and still enjoy a lot of fitness. They are likely to only be used by a single person.
For example the iFit-enabled treadmill offered by NordicTrack is packed with smart features that are normally reserved for more expensive models, including live classes and on-demand training delivered on the 14-inch HD touchscreen. It comes with a month-long membership to the iFit App as well as Google Maps Integration that allows users to simulate outdoor running anywhere around the globe.
It's not as sturdy or quiet as the best-rated runners, and it has an uninspiringly small screen that can make it difficult to monitor your progress under bright light. It's not difficult to put together, though, and customers say the detailed instructions are easy to follow.
Performance
If you're running for work or jogging to burn calories, treadmills can make staying active a breeze. A lot of treadmills have innovative features and bright touchscreens that keep you motivated even when it's rainy outside. Some are compatible with fitness apps, which let you enjoy a full-on experience of on-demand workouts and live workouts. However, the majority of these have a monthly subscription fee that can be expensive over time.
The cost of your treadmill is determined by the frequency at which you use your treadmill, the people who will be using it, if you're planning to do cardio exercises, speed and the incline, as well as what you plan to do with it. Gym-standard machines will be better able to handle more intense workouts, and will have more robust construction than the cheaper consumer models.
If you're a fast running enthusiast, it's worthwhile spending more to get a machine that is capable of reaching high speeds. You'll need a model that has an incline of as high as 15%, and can reach speeds of 18 km/h. This is ideal for those who prefer to run or jog rather than walk.
